Upbit Reassures Investors Following False APT Token Deposits
Following a recent situation where false Aptos (APT) tokens were mistakenly accepted as authentic deposits, Upbit, South Korea’s leading cryptocurrency exchange, has reassured investors that such problems will not recur.

Irregular Aptos token deposits
An Upbit representative informed local news outlet Digital Asset that the platform had detected irregular deposit activities related to Aptos-based tokens of the same type on September 24. In response, the platform addressed the coding anomalies during the suspension of APT deposits and withdrawals.
Software correction
The representative said that, as the resumption of APT deposits and withdrawals took place at 23:00 KST on September 24 after the software correction, no virtual assets on the exchange, including APT, should face similar issues in the future.
Asset monitoring
The official highlighted that the trading platform employs a real-time process that monitors and compares customer assets with on-chain assets, a step that contributed to the mitigation of the fallout from the incident.
